چکیده مقاله:
In this paper, an agricultural super absorbent based on acrylic acid, carboxy methyl cellulose and urea has been produced, which has the ability to absorb maximum saline water under load - the closest test to the actual soil conditions. In this paper, instead of using acrylamide, which is the term monomer in the field of agricultural super absorbent production, urea is a significant percentage of superabsorbent. Urea is an inexpensive domestic substance that has the ability to absorb relatively high water, so in addition to reducing the price of the final product, it is also used as agricultural fertilizer, which also helps the biodegradability of this product.This hydrogel was compared with commercial samples on the market and showed better results in tests of water retention and absorption under load than commercial samples.
